Transaction 87236e0f532af515f20b9a6c8c28183a5deab4ab9bc17658e6ab052f5b9ac904

3 Input
1 Outputs
  • 87236e0f532af515f20b9a6c8c28183a5deab4ab9bc17658e6ab052f5b9ac904:0
  • value  5690799
    address  16L98rGU7r6ZUAGS29aWZajz1eX7xcPALh